Using Butterfly Font in Adobe Photoshop and Illustrator
For more advanced designers, Adobe Photoshop and Illustrator offer a range of creative possibilities. Here’s how to use the Butterfly font in these platforms:
- Install the Butterfly font on your computer by following the standard font installation process
- Open Photoshop or Illustrator and select the Butterfly font from the font dropdown menu
- Explore the font’s glyphs and stylistic alternates using the “Glyphs” panel in Illustrator or the “Character” panel in Photoshop
- Adjust the font size, color, and style to fit your design needs

Similar Fonts and Alternatives
If you love the Butterfly font, you might also enjoy these similar fonts and alternatives:
- Lacey: A beautiful, handwritten font with a similar delicate and elegant feel to Butterfly. Use it for feminine designs, such as wedding invitations or branding materials.
- Carolyna Pro: A elegant, script font with a similar flowing feel to Butterfly. Use it for more formal designs, such as business cards or certificates.
- Alex Brush: A whimsical, handwritten font with a similar playful feel to Butterfly. Use it for more creative designs, such as children’s books or social media graphics.
- Great Vibes: A modern, script font with a similar elegant feel to Butterfly. Use it for designs that require a touch of sophistication, such as luxury branding or advertising materials.
